[prev in list] [next in list] [prev in thread] [next in thread]
List: crux
Subject: Re: Errors during Compilation
From: Florian Weber <Florian.Weber () pfaffenhofen ! de>
Date: 2002-06-18 7:59:15
[Download RAW message or body]
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
> Alright, I'm going to have to agree with Markus and Per on this one.
> Perhaps, if you're really lazy, you could ask Per to put in a logging
> feature, rather then putting "alias pkglog='pkgmk -d > pkgmk.log 2>&1'"
> in /etc/profile and typing pkglog each time instead.
That would be great ... even better, if it could be split in two files (or two
easily distinguishable parts): one for pkgmk's activity (source extraction,
package building) and one for the output of the build() function.
And while we're at it: what about including the package name in the log-name?
Great for recursive builds! (yes, I'm a big fan of those)
Not really a 'wish', just food for thought.
> discussion regarding dependency checking, and even a patch submitted
> that added the functionality. Having missed out on the fun, can you
> recap for me Per?).
I won't tell you the reason.
After all, I'm not Per ;-)
But not having dependencies was the prime reason that brought me to CRUX. I
could imagine having non-binding dependencies (echo "You probably should
install this and that first"). But that can also be accomplished with a few
comments in the Pkgfile.
In fact, I would like to encourage everyone to include this information in
their Pkgfiles, as even experienced people are likely to miss some of the
optional dependencies.
Florian
- --
PGP key ID: 3C4E74DC
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.0.6 (GNU/Linux)
Comment: For info see http://www.gnupg.org
iD8DBQE9DuhTm8fasDxOdNwRAkxUAKDiP9Nl43etA0n4kOVMv3kJd202vgCgoMPM
aj3ZeZeq9fiDzELTQAV8no8=
=w8oX
-----END PGP SIGNATURE-----
[prev in list] [next in list] [prev in thread] [next in thread]
Configure |
About |
News |
Add a list |
Sponsored by KoreLogic